Heath Mathis has always loved Ezra Ryder. Ezra is the beta second in charge of the West Wind Pack. Heath never thought he had a chance with the man who grew up as his big brother’s best friend. When a string of murders happen in West Wind, the evidence trail leads Heath to the tiny town of Silver Lake. Ezra refuses to let Heath go into danger alone. But Heath is afraid his feelings for Ezra will confuse him, and he will not be able to do his job. Ezra won’t take no for an answer. Can Heath find the serial killer or killers while keeping his heart intact?





Heath and Ezra from Shadow Games were great characters developed in the mind of Kalista Kyle. Sexy and dominant Ezra has loved his mate from afar while being with him every day. Heath has never understood why his mate was so protective yet aloof when it came to their mating. Ms. Kyle wrote the perfect union of two loving souls.

I loved Ezra; his slightly gruff yet gentle nature~ the way he watched his mate's every move~ but most especially when he called Heath angel. He made me swoon and smile.

Shadow Games was suspenseful and kept me guessing. Rabble rousing wolves and vampires, I wasn’t sure who to trust as Heath attempted to find a serial killer on the loose.

The loving slow buildup of Ezra and Heath’s relationship was wonderfully done. Even though the men had always known they were mates, there was no insta-love, but a careful synergy of getting to know each other on a different level. Very refreshing and kudos to Ms. Kyle for not being sucked in.

I love Ms. Kyle’s edgy style of writing. She’s quick with wit and seamless dialogue. I’m a definite fan of her work.

Definite S.E.X.
A five handcuff review
